Alfred E. "Alf" Bauman (Football, 1939-42)

"Alf" Bauman starred at tackle for the 1939, '40 and '41 Wildcat football teams. He was the team's Most Valuable Player in 1941, leading the Wildcats to a 5-3 mark, just one year after NU had finished with a fine 6-2 record.

Bauman was named to numerous All-American teams in 1940 and 1941 and he was designated as national lineman of the year in 1940. He participated in both the East-West Shrine Game and the College All-Star Game following his graduation in 1942. He joined the U.S. Army that year, then went on to play professionally for the Chicago Rockets (1947), Philadelphia Eagles (1947) and Chicago Bears (1948-50).
